Essential Duties And Responsibilities
Manage and operate ticketing system (currently Paciolan/TicketsWest), including event building, ticket and promotion configuration, user security, ticket design and proofing.
Communicate with donors, general public, students and faculty‑staff to resolve seating needs, complaints, and staff support.
Assist the Compliance Office in enforcing NCAA regulations related to ticketing for home competitions, including recruits, high school coaches, players, families, general public, and donors.
Implement individual game, season ticket, and group sales strategies for athletic ticketed sporting events with an emphasis on growing fan base and revenue.
Develop and execute sales and marketing plans, including design and implementation of all comprehensive season ticket and group sales strategies.
Assist in establishing annual revenue goals and implementing initiatives to increase attendance and ticket sales across all sports.
Manage ticketing operations for assigned athletic events and various on‑campus events, including printing of tickets, managing complimentary pass lists, managing group ticket lists, overseeing will‑call operations, managing student workers, and reconciling cash with detailed financial reports at the closing of day’s business operations.
Coordinate with various members of the athletics department, including marketing, communications, media production, development, facilities and event management.
Prepare regular ticket sales audits and reports through the ticket system to reflect revenue and attendance at CBU events.
Organize duplicate customer accounts, working with campus departments to keep records up‑to‑date and assisting customers with address changes throughout the year.
Work with CRM tools to track customer interactions, segment fanbases, and deploy targeted ticketing campaigns in coordination with marketing and development.
Coordinate event logistics as needed with other event staff to ensure operational readiness, efficiency and resource utilization for consistent fulfillment of services related to ticketing and satisfactory customer service.
Assist the Associate Athletic Director for External and Corporate Relations with corporate sponsorship sales and service initiatives.
Identify and qualify prospective corporate partners; maintain and update a comprehensive prospect database.
Support the development and preparation of sponsorship proposals, presentations and sales materials.
Coordinate and execute sponsorship activations, ensuring fulfillment of contractual obligations.
Provide account support for assigned partners, including communication, service and renewal assistance.
Maintain and track sponsorship inventory, including signage, digital assets and in‑game promotional elements.
Assist in the preparation of post‑event and annual partnership reports, including performance metrics and proof of fulfillment.
Ensure all sponsorship activities comply with institutional policies, conference guidelines, NCAA regulations and partner exclusivity agreements.
